Gene Name | ZNF90 |
|
Specie | Homo sapiens | |
Full Name | zinc finger protein 90 | |
Also known as | HTF9 | |
Coordinate | chr19:20078000-20121165 | |
Strand | + | |
Gene summary | Predicted to enable DNA-binding transcription factor activity, RNA polymerase II-specific and RNA polymerase II cis-regulatory region sequence-specific DNA binding activity. Predicted to be involved in regulation of transcription, DNA-templated. Predicted to be located in nucleus. [provided by Alliance of Genome Resources, Apr 2022] |
